When considering the place to take your trip photos, assume beyond the everyday vacationer spots. While iconic landmarks are value capturing, a variety of the most original and beautiful photographs come from less-traveled paths. Local markets, quaint alleyways, and untouched natural landscapes can present a refreshing backdrop on your photographs.


Lighting plays a vital role in photography. The golden hour, simply after sunrise or earlier than sunset, presents a soft, flattering gentle that enhances colors and provides heat to your photos. Take benefit of this natural mild to realize gorgeous effects. Midday solar can create harsh shadows and overexposed images, so adjusting your capturing instances can vastly enhance your outcomes.


Experimenting with angles and perspectives could make even the most odd scenes seem extraordinary. Instead of shooting from eye degree, strive crouching down or finding greater floor for a fresh perspective. These uncommon angles can create dynamic compositions that draw the viewer's eye. Incorporating individuals into your photographs can present a way of scale and context. A solitary determine against a vast panorama conveys the sheer magnitude of nature's magnificence, whereas a bunch of friends or family can illustrate joy and connection. Candid moments typically evoke genuine emotions, allowing others to feel a part of your experience.


Focusing on particulars can add depth to your photographs. Zoom in on the textures of a neighborhood dish, the intricate designs of a landmark, or the expressions of your journey companions. Close-up pictures can spotlight the distinctive traits of a location, turning an ordinary photograph into something special.


In the age of digital photography, post-processing has become an integral a part of capturing great photographs. Utilizing editing software can help enhance colours, appropriate publicity, and refine composition after the precise fact. However, it's important to take care of a stability. Over-editing can result in unrealistic pictures that detract from the authenticity of your experiences.




Incorporating local tradition can enrich your vacation photos considerably. Try to incorporate elements that characterize the tradition, whether or not it be conventional clothing, art, or structure. This adds context and curiosity, reworking your images from easy vacation memories into cultural portrayals.

What settings should I use on my camera for night photography?


Use a wide aperture (low f-stop number) for better light intake, a slower shutter speed to capture extra gentle, and enhance ISO settings to brighten pictures with out introducing an extreme quantity of noise. A tripod is important.
